Abstract

The invention provides a movable dismounting and mounting support for a flashlight, and belongs to the field of auxiliary tools. The movable dismounting and mounting support comprises a magnetic base, a screw connecting rod and a movable connecting rod. The magnetic base is provided with a magnetic base switch. The screw connecting rod comprises a screw, a swivel nut and a rotation piece. The screw is rotationally arranged on the top of the magnetic base in the vertical direction. The swivel nut is arranged outside the screw in a sleeving manner and is in threaded connection with the screw. The rotation piece is movably arranged outside the screw in a sleeving manner and is supported at the top of the swivel nut. One end of the movable connecting rod is connected with the rotation piece, and a flashlight installing frame is arranged at the other end of the movable connecting rod. An annular ring is arranged on the top of the magnetic base in the transverse direction, landing legs are arranged at the bottom of the annular ring, and a plurality of guiding blocks are arranged on the inner side wall of the annular ring. A plurality of vertical guiding grooves are formed in the outer side wall of the swivel nut. The annular ring is arranged outside the swivel nut in a sleeving manner. Each guiding block is embedded in the corresponding vertical guiding groove in a sliding manner. According to the technical scheme, the support for the flashlight to be installed conveniently is provided, lighting overhauling can be conducted without holding the flashlight by hand after the support is used, carrying is convenient, and the overhauling efficiency is improved.

Description

A kind of torch moves dismounting support
Technical field
The present invention relates to aid field, move dismounting support in particular to torch.
Background technology
In real life, many employings flashlight lighting during because of equipment such as interruption maintenance distribution box, automobile or machineries, if people's maintenance, operate inconvenience, a hands operation can only hold pocket lamp, another hands operates, and not only illumination can not be stablized, but also affects the efficiency of maintenance.
Summary of the invention
It is an object of the invention to provide a kind of torch and move dismounting support, to improve above-mentioned problem.
The present invention is achieved in that
Torch provided by the invention moves dismounting support and includes magnetic support, screw connecting rod and movable rod;Magnetic support is provided with magnetic support switch, screw connecting rod includes screw rod, swivel nut and tumbler, screw rod vertical rotating is arranged at the top of magnetic support, and swivel nut is sheathed on the outside of screw rod and is connected with screw flight, and tumbler is movably set in the outside of screw rod and is supported in the top of swivel nut;One end of movable rod is connected with tumbler, and the other end of movable rod is provided with torch installing rack;The top of magnetic support is horizontally arranged with annular ring, the bottom of annular ring is provided with supporting leg, and the medial wall of annular ring is provided with multiple guide pad, and the lateral wall of swivel nut is provided with multiple vertical gathering sill, annular ring is sheathed on the outside of swivel nut, and each guide pad slides and is embedded in a vertical gathering sill.
Time actually used, pocket lamp is arranged on torch installing rack.Screw rod rotates, and due to the effect of guide pad and vertical gathering sill, swivel nut direction only along vertical gathering sill under the effect of screw rod moves up and down, it is achieved the adjustment of pocket lamp height.Tumbler can circumferentially rotate around screw rod at the top of swivel nut, it is achieved pocket lamp position adjustments in transverse plane.Movable rod is connected with tumbler, it is possible to is be flexibly connected or fixing connection, is flexibly connected the adjustment of the gradient that can realize movable rod.By above-mentioned horizontal and vertical adjustment, enable the light of pocket lamp to be irradiated to the position needing maintenance more fully, provide for service work and better overhaul visual angle, improve the efficiency of maintenance.
During practical operation, first choose repairing lighting position, then magnetic support is positioned over repairing lighting position, open magnetic support switch, make magnetic support be fixed on device location.Magnetic support can lie against equipment surface and use, it is also possible to sidewall is inhaled and used in device side, it is also possible to top is inhaled and used in device side.Select according to actual repairing lighting position.It should be noted that in the application, the rotary power of screw rod can adopt following actuating unit, this actuating unit includes motor and travelling gear, is connected by travelling gear between screw rod with motor, and motor drives travelling gear to rotate, and then drive screw turns.Screw rod can realize rotating.
Further, the top of screw rod is provided with limit switch.Screw drive swivel nut moves up and down, and when the top of swivel nut props up limit switch, screw rod stops operating or rotates backward, it is possible to is prevented effectively from swivel nut and skids off screw rod, it is ensured that the normal use of support.
Further, the top outer sheath of swivel nut is provided with the first support platform, first top supporting platform is provided with multiple spacing block set and multiple installation groove, multiple installation grooves are arranged around screw rod, sliding and be embedded in installation groove in the bottom of each spacing block set, spacing block set is connected by the first spring between groove with installing;The bottom of tumbler is provided with multiple limited impression, slides and be embedded in a limited impression in the top of each spacing block set;The top of multiple spacing block sets is respectively arranged with the inclined plane that direction is identical, and when inclined plane is subject to the rotary action power of tumbler, spacing block set can be retracted in installation groove.
The purpose arranging spacing block set is in that, controls the rotational angle of tumbler and the turned position of restriction tumbler.The roof of each spacing block set is inclined plane, when tumbler rotates, the sidewall of limited impression can force in inclined plane, inclined plane stress, spacing block set moves in installation groove, being rotated further tumbler, spacing block set is fully retracted in installation groove, and tumbler is rotated further, when limited impression moves the top to next spacing block set, now the top of spacing block set in the effect lower slider of the first spring in limited impression, if tumbler is rotated further, then repeating above-mentioned process.Owing to the setting direction of the inclined plane at each spacing block set top is consistent, therefore tumbler continues to rotate only along a direction, and reciprocal rotation can not occur.Namely angle between adjacent two spacing block sets is that tumbler often rotates the angle that once can rotate.
Further, being provided with the second support platform between the first support platform and tumbler, second supports platform is sheathed on the outside of screw rod and is flexibly connected with screw rod;Second supports platform is vertically provided with multiple through channel, and multiple through channel are arranged around screw rod, the middle part traverse through channel of each spacing block set;First supports platform is movably set in the outside of swivel nut, and the sidewall of swivel nut is provided with the shackle member moved axially of restriction the first support platform.
Tumbler is placed in the top of the second support platform, and the top slide of spacing block set is embedded in limited impression, and through channel is run through at middle part.When needing to release the annexation between limited impression and spacing block set, remove or mobile shackle member, then the second support platform will glide outside swivel nut, and second supports platform is still supported in the top of swivel nut, then spacing block set will exit in limited impression, and removes through channel.And then realize the separation between spacing block set and limited impression, it is simple to and dismounting and installation, it is convenient for carrying.
Further, shackle member includes clamping block and the clamping groove of the sidewall being horizontally set at swivel nut, and clamping groove is positioned at the bottom of the first support platform, and clamping block is slided and is embedded in clamping groove and is connected by the second spring with between clamping groove.
When needing to remove spacing block set, exterior mechanical aid is utilized to be pressed into by clamping block in clamping groove, now second support platform and glide due to the lateral wall along swivel nut affected by gravity, second supports platform is supported in the top of swivel nut, therefore, second supports platform and second supports platform separation, and then separates with tumbler, thus spacing block set exits in limited impression.When to be installed in limited impression at the top of spacing block set, pressing clamping block, move up the second support platform, and clamping block ejects under the effect of the second spring and is supported on the bottom of the first support platform.
Further, the diapire of the part stretching out clamping groove of shackle member is arcwall, when shackle member is subject to from the axial force on the sensing top, bottom of screw rod, and shackle member retraction clamping groove.
After first support platform and second supports platform separation, when spacing block set position relationship in limited impression need to be recovered, move up the first support platform, owing to the diapire of clamping block is arcwall, when the first roof supporting platform acts on the diapire of clamping block, while first support platform moves up, clamping block moves towards the inner transverse of clamping groove, when first supports the top that platform moves to clamping block, clamping block is subject to the active force ejecting card of the second spring and is connected to the bottom of the first support platform, then the top slide of spacing block set is embedded in limited impression.
Further, tumbler is cuboid, the sidewall of tumbler is provided with and rotates axle and around rotating the circular chute that axle is arranged, the diapire of circular chute is arranged at intervals with multiple tapped blind hole, the end of movable rod is rotationally connected with rotating axle, movable rod is equipped with caging bolt, and caging bolt and tapped blind hole are mutually matched.
Arranging circular chute and be capable of pocket lamp adjustment at any angle in vertical plane, pocket lamp can rotate 360 deg in vertical plane.During practical operation, unscrew caging bolt, utilize manpower to make movable rod rotate a certain position to vertical plane, then screwing bolts, make caging bolt threaded with tapped blind hole, and then realize being limited in movable rod this position, it is achieved pocket lamp angular adjustment in vertical plane.
Further, torch installing rack includes pressing handle and hold-down ring, hold-down ring is provided with breach, the end, one end of hold-down ring is provided with the first union joint, the other end end of hold-down ring is provided with the second union joint, first union joint is fixed on the end of movable rod, and the end of pressing handle is through the second union joint and the end pressing on movable rod.
When installing pocket lamp, being placed in hold-down ring by pocket lamp, then rotatably compress handle, constantly rotatably compress handle, until hold-down ring compresses pocket lamp, pocket lamp does not fall out.This pocket lamp installing rack simple in construction, convenient to operation.
Further, movable rod includes moving screw and the movable sleeving in the outside being sheathed on moving screw, and torch installing rack is installed on the end of movable sleeving.
The length of movable rod can regulate, and time actually used, by positive and negative rotation movable sleeving, it is achieved the adjustment of movable rod length, and then can regulate the position of pocket lamp according to actual use scene.
Further, being connected by rotary sleeve between movable sleeving with torch installing rack, rotary sleeve is sheathed on the end of movable sleeving, is threaded connection between medial wall and the lateral wall of movable sleeving of rotary sleeve.
Rotary sleeve can rotate around the axial line of moving screw, can regulate the angle of pocket lamp by regulating rotary sleeve, expands the range of accommodation of pocket lamp further, and the illuminating effect making maintenance position is better, improves overhaul efficiency and quality.
Beneficial effects of the present invention: the technical program provides a kind of lamp used for electrical equipment or miscellaneous equipment repairing lighting, this torch moves the installation of the torch that dismounting support needs for service works such as daily power industry distribution box, switch cubicle and other industry device, easy to carry dismantled and assembled, operate with simple, can greatly improve work efficiency.
